Description
This is a short, tree covered 9-hole course offered by Reeds Spring School District for the Table Rock Community. Turf tee boxes and brand new Dynamic Disc equipment. Beautifully maintained in the heart of the Ozarks.

Accessibility
Limited mobility/cane accessible - There is a manicured running trail circling the course making navigation with a cane or limited mobility possible. There are trees throughout the course and fairways are not smooth, so take care when moving along hole routes.

History
This course was added as part of the Wolf Pack Park community recreation facility development. The Reeds Spring School District offers the Wolf Pack Park as a community resource with disc golf, tennis, pickleball, concessions, pavilion, walking/running/biking trails, and accessible playground. Wolf Pack Park was made possible by numerous community sponsorships and the dedicated efforts of the Reeds Spring School District. The course is maintained year round by the staff of Reeds Spring School District and is open to the public for free. Come enjoy the hospitality of the Wolf Pack at this beautiful new park.
